Transaction 233d59e3239ae5f98b6e768fe3e23d575f8088976a3d852b9c57b46c473c5732

11 Input
1 Outputs
  • 233d59e3239ae5f98b6e768fe3e23d575f8088976a3d852b9c57b46c473c5732:0
  • value  20373390
    address  bc1qsennpwexvrlygldqr0zswfp8stwvl875h8cd2u